Step-by-step

  • Season pork with salt and pepper.
  • Press saute on the instant pot, spray with oil and brown the pork on all sides for about 5 minutes.
  • Remove from heat and allow to cool.
  • Using a sharp knife, insert blade into pork about 1-inch deep, and insert the garlic slivers; repeat all over.
  • Season pork with cumin, sazon, oregano, adobo and garlic powder all over.
  • Pour chicken broth, add chipotle peppers and stir, add bay leaves and place pork in the Instant Pot, cover and cook using the pressure cooker setting on high pressure for 80 minutes.
  • When the pressure releases, shred pork using two forks and combine well with the juices that accumulated at the bottom.
  • Remove bay leaves and adjust cumin and add adobo and mix well.

Tips and Variations

Feel free to experiment with different spice combinations to personalize this recipe to your liking. Adding a touch of orange zest or a splash of apple cider vinegar can add another layer of complexity. You can also adjust the amount of chipotle peppers to control the level of spiciness. For a heartier meal, consider adding some sauteed onions and bell peppers to the Instant Pot along with the pork.

Leftovers? Don't worry! These carnitas freeze beautifully. Simply store them in an airtight container in the freezer for up to 3 months. This makes meal prep for busy weeks even more convenient. Simply reheat in the microwave or stovetop when you are ready to enjoy.
